Türkiye''s energy transformation and renewable energy targets include significant growth and diversification until 2035. Minister of Energy and Natural Resources Alparslan Bayraktar said that Türkiye targets 120 thousand megawatts of wind and solar installed power in 2035 and will invest 80 billion dollars for this.
Türkiye''s new energy plan offers a fivefold rise in solar power capacity by 2035, with yearly projected new solar installations between 3-4 GW. However, the country has added around 1.2 GW solar power capacity annually in the last five years.
Solar energy generation in Türkiye set new records in 2024, providing a significant contribution to meeting the rising demand, particularly in hot summer months, a new report by London-based energy think tank Ember showed.

Türkiye is making significant strides toward its 2053 net-zero carbon emissions goal by ramping up investments in energy storage systems according to Türkiye daily. The Energy Market Regulatory Authority approved a 35-gigawatt-hour (GWh) capacity allocation for grid-scale storage projects, with an estimated investment of $10 billion.
The target for battery storage is 7.5 GW. With these and other clean energy measures, the government is boosting energy security as an integral part of efforts to decarbonize Türkiye’s economy by 2053. The government aims to significantly scale-up solar energy to 52.9 gigawatts (GW) by 2035 from 9.5 GW in 2022. The target for battery storage is 7.5 GW. Energate is one of the Turkish solar brands with expansion plans in the United States. Photo: pv magazine/Matthew Lynas Europe’s largest vertically integrated module manufacturer is based in Türkiye. The continent’s largest solar array, the 1.35 GW Kalyon Karapinar PV power plant, is also found there. This did not happen by accident.
